Azure SQL vs AWS RDS - Which Managed Database Service is Better?
Managed databases are becoming increasingly popular in the world of cloud computing. They offer many benefits such as scalability, reliability, and cost-effectiveness. Azure SQL and AWS RDS are two of the most popular managed database services in the market. In this blog post, we will compare Azure SQL and AWS RDS and determine which one is better.
Azure SQL
Azure SQL is a managed database service offered by Microsoft Azure. It provides a fully managed database service that is easy to use and highly scalable. It is built on top of SQL Server and provides many features such as automatic backups, automatic tuning, and high availability. Azure SQL is also highly customizable, allowing users to choose from a range of database engines, performance tiers, and storage options.
Azure SQL provides many benefits, such as:
- Automatic backups
- High scalability
- Automatic tuning
- High availability
- Customizable performance tiers
- Customizable storage options
Azure SQL has a pricing model based on usage, so users only pay for what they use. The cost of Azure SQL is highly competitive and can be less than other managed database services on the market.
AWS RDS
AWS RDS is a managed database service offered by Amazon Web Services. It provides a fully managed database service that is highly scalable and easy to use. AWS RDS provides many features such as automatic backups, automatic scaling, and high availability. It is also highly customizable, allowing users to choose from a range of database engines and performance tiers.
AWS RDS provides many benefits, such as:
- Automatic backups
- High scalability
- Automatic scaling
- High availability
- Customizable performance tiers
AWS RDS has a pricing model based on usage, so users only pay for what they use. The cost of AWS RDS is highly competitive and can be less than other managed database services on the market.
Comparison
Now that we have looked at the features and benefits of both Azure SQL and AWS RDS, it's time to compare them. Here's a table that provides a quick comparison between Azure SQL and AWS RDS:
Azure SQL | AWS RDS | |
---|---|---|
Automatic backups | Yes | Yes |
High scalability | Yes | Yes |
Automatic tuning | Yes | No |
High availability | Yes | Yes |
Customizable performance tiers | Yes | Yes |
Customizable storage options | Yes | No |
Automatic scaling | No | Yes |
As we can see from the above comparison, both Azure SQL and AWS RDS have many similarities. They both offer automatic backups, high scalability, and high availability. However, Azure SQL offers more customizable features, such as customizable storage options and automatic tuning. AWS RDS, on the other hand, offers automatic scaling, which Azure SQL does not.
Conclusion
In conclusion, both Azure SQL and AWS RDS are excellent managed database services that provide many benefits. Choosing one over the other depends on the user's specific needs and requirements. Azure SQL is a good option for users who require highly customizable features, while AWS RDS is a good option for users who require automatic scaling. Ultimately, both services provide a reliable and cost-effective solution for managed databases.